Title The Long Ballad Spoiler
Several things about & between the Chang Ge & A’sun that the drama omitted/not included if you want to know…
Chang Ge & A’sun were enemies from the beginning. They don’t know much about each other.

Chang Ge is really cunning & persuasive.

A’sun doesn’t read or write well in Chinese.

Chang Ge persuades A’sun to become his strategist who helps & saves him during the grasslands.

A'sun allows Change Ge to do as she pleases & gifts her things like a new tent, food, clothes etc for being a great strategist. She's not treated like a slave or captive.

A'dou is Change Ge trustee advisor and he does NOT die.

A’sun does not know that Chang Ge is a girl, he finds out by Master Qin.

A’sun choking on wine when Qin tells him that Chang Ge is a girl.

Chang Ge is sickly. She walked barefoot in the snow when she first met A’sun.

Chang Ge does know that she is of Uyghur heritage.

Mimi was Chang Ge’s wife lol.

Chang Ge receives the seal to command the 18 Horsemen of Yan Yun.

A’sun calls Change Ge his “brother” & gives Change Ge her freedom.

A’sun figures out that he is Khitan, not Mongolain/Turk.

A'sun goes to find his origin of birth. His backstory in the manhua is but so heartbreaking.

Because Chang Ge assumes multiple identity, A’sun feels like he’s ‘tricked’ by her lol.

In this point of the manhua, Chang Ge has met her Uncle Pusa, the Uyghur Elteber. Chang Ge and A'sun are not together since they both part ways. There was a battle of warring factions between Uyghur & the Greater Khan/Turks. Chang Ge becomes an advisor to her Uncle Pusa while A'sun fights along with the Turks. They did not know that they would fight eachother but A'sun fails and is captured. Chang Ge realized this after the battle was over so she thinks that the man her Uncle Pusa hangs/kills is A'sun. She becomes distraught and cries out not knowing A'sun is alive and tied up. She faints and A'sun hears it & sees her from inside Uncle Pusa residence. He frees himself from the ropes & runs to her side. It was very hilarious & sweet.

When she wakes up, Chang Ge thought she was talking to A'sun's apparition/ghost in the dark but it was actually him lol. She cries even more & apologizes for the situation they were put in. It was a really great moment between them.
